Payment Types Accepted: bank to bank Wire Transfer (preferred), Cashier's Check, Postal M.O.s Description: Exceptional condition early Model 70 30-06 Target rifle with an integral front sight ramp, which is an extremely rare feature exclusive to only the very first Target rifles produced. Some authorities have suggested that fewer than 50 were made with these carryover barrel blanks from the production era of its famed predecessor, the Model 54. S/N 5284 with matching scribed bolt unveiled in early 1937. The metal condition is outstanding, showing near 98% on the beautiful rust blued barrel and the rare polished, carbonum blued receiver. The bottom metal is also nice but does show some carry wear and typical light flaking on the trigger guard. The wood is not far behind with its beautiful original lacquer, but does have a few scattered dings, most notably on the R side near the buttplate. The buttplate transition shows the correct slightly radiused cut with a good overall fit, but the length of pull is about 12 3/4", so appears to have been shortened about 1/2" at some point in time. All of the very unique early features of this special gun are present and correct including a square faced floorplate release plunger, "fat" bolt release plunger, "target" stamped trigger, under forearm rail "in the white", etc. The original sights and scope blocks are also correct which consist of a Lyman 17 globe front, and the factory inletted full block Lyman 48 WJS receiver sight (most Target rifles had the Lyman 48WH but not these), along with original dimpled scope blocks. The receiver sight's inner component #s are all matching. The top of rear receiver bridge remains UNDRILLED. The barrel is the correct 24" with a minty bore. All mechanical functions are crisp and working properly as well. A beautiful and very rare rifle for the Model 70 collector!
